Bhadrachalam in Telangana is home to the Sita Ramachandra Swamy Temple. Located near the Godavari River, the mandir is believed to be the site where Lord Ram crossed the river during his quest to rescue Sita.

Sita Ramachandraswamy Temple,Telangana 

Located in Jammu, the Raghunath Temple is a prominent Shrine dedicated to lord Ram. The impressive complex has seven additional temples devoted to various other deities.

Raghunath Temple, Jammu

The Triprayar Sri Rama Temple is a popular mandir located in Kerala's Thrissur district. It is believed that the deity here was worshipped by Lord Krishna.

Triprayar Sri Rama Temple, Kerala

Located in Karnataka's Chikkamagaluru district, the Kondanda Ramaswami Temple depicts scenes from Lord Ram's marriage. This temple stands out as the only one in India with Sita on the right, Ram in the center, and Lakshman on the left.

kodanda Ramaswamy Temple, Chikmagalur

Tamil Nadu's Ramaswamy Temple, often referred to as the Ayodhya of the south, showcased magnificent carvings illustrating Significant events from the Ramayana.

Ramaswamy Temple, Tamil Nadu

Situated in Amritsar, this temple is Known for its ancient well that is believed to have healing powers. It is linked with the birth of Luv and Kush, the children of Ram.

Ram Tirath Temple, Punjab

This temple features Jatayu on Vijayaghava Perumal's lap, symbolizing the place where Ram performed the last rites for the noble bird.

Sri Vijayaraghava Perumal Temple, Tamil Nadu

Known for its magnificent architecture and opulent designs, Kodandarama Temple is a famous Ram Temple is a famous Ram Temple in Andhra Pradesh. It is said to have been built by Vontudu and Mittudu, former robbers turned devotees of Ram.

Kodandarama Temple, Andhra Pradesh
